Pinterest beats Q1 estimates, lifts Q2 outlook
Pinterest reported first-quarter results that beat analyst estimates, with revenue rising 18% year on year.
Its second-quarter guidance also topped Wall Street forecasts, sending shares up 17%.
Revenue reached US$855 million versus LSEG estimates of US$847 million, while adjusted EBITDA was US$207 million against a US$176 million estimate.
The company posted a net loss of US$73.6 million, or 12 cents a share, compared with net income of US$8.9 million a year earlier.
Pinterest forecast second-quarter revenue of US$1.13 billion to US$1.15 billion and adjusted EBITDA of US$256 million to US$276 million.
Its global monthly active users rose 11% to 631 million and average revenue per user came in at US$1.61.

Growth comes after an AI-led restructuring
- Pinterest posted a strong earnings report a few months after saying it would cut less than 15% of its staff 1.
- The plan shifted money and people toward AI product and engineering work, including an AI-powered shopping assistant 1.
- Pinterest said the restructuring would bring US$35 million to US$45 million in pre-tax charges and back its “AI-forward strategy” 2.
- The results may give investors more confidence that the overhaul is starting to pay off.
AI-driven cuts are changing tech teams
- Pinterest is part of a wider tech pattern where companies tie layoffs to a move into AI 1.
- Some experts are skeptical and say some firms may be “AI-washing,” using AI language to explain what are still standard cost cuts 1.
- Amazon earlier said it would cut about 14,000 corporate jobs, nearly 4% of its workforce, while raising AI spending and cutting costs in other areas 3.
- Pinterest’s results may strengthen the appeal of that approach, which could displace more workers in older tech roles and sharpen competition for scarce AI talent 3.
